Our team

We are faculty who study ethology. We primarily conduct research in the field of animal welfare, and work to understand how human-managed animals perceive and respond to their environments. We have studied a variety of species and used many different techniques. Our perspective on reliability has been guided by our experience and teaching others how to do the same. History of this site

We developed this site as a resource for our own labs and for other scientists. These ideas and materials are part of our commitment to rigor, transparency, and reproducibility in our research.
